  • Brief Bio

    Min-Yang Chou is a Research Scientist at NASA GSFC, Community Coordinated Modeling Center. He received his Ph.D. degree from National Cheng Kung University in Taiwan in 2018. Before joining CCMC, he was a postdoctoral fellow at University Corporation for Atmospheric Research, COSMIC Program Office from 2019 to 2021. He has been involved in the Taiwan-U.S. joint satellite missions, FORMOSAT-3/COSMIC and FORMOSAT-7/COSMIC2, developing the first Taiwan ionospheric RO Processing System (TROPS) with TACC and National Space Organization in Taiwan. His research interest is understanding how atmospheric waves affect the ionosphere by using various ground-based, spaceborne satellite observations and numerical models. Currently, he is interested in understanding the impacts of atmospheric gravity waves on the day-to-day variability of equatorial ionospheric plasma bubbles.
